I know i know.
there are other posts about this issue but I will always keep this thread open until the problem is resolved.
Today I go to drop off my son to daycare. I of course always turn off my car. I was inside for 2 minutes then went to leave. I push the start button and it starts flashing green, and the message pops up to “Stop Safely”. The shifter won’t turn into N or D or even R. The time is 12:45pm. I call roadside assistance and they dispatch a tow. Thank god its only 45 degrees out. 4 hours go by… Now in this time ford stays in contact with you to see if the tow service has arrived. I keep texting back “N” for no.
Fast forward to the 4 hour and 15 minute mark. I call ford roadside and ask whats going on. They called the first tow company. Turns out they just cancelled.
So here we go dispatching another tow tow company who cancelled because they wont touch the EV. Third tow company gets dispatched. Its now 6:21pm. Tow company shows up and “didn't know it was electric” so he cancels and drives away. Currently as I type this Im now freezing because i have been in a car with bo heat for over 6 hours.A fourth tow company has been dispatched andI am awaiting to hear wether or not they will actually tow the car. I will keep you updated. Meanwhile the car is going CRAZY with lights. Headlights turning on and off the break lights are spazzing out and doing a tesla light show.
This is an absolute nightmare.
